Peter and all,
I ended up paying $700 including the installation. The glass is the Ford Privacy glass and the installation takes quite a bit longer than you would think. Notice that there is no trim piece around the window like there is on the original slider. The window bolts in and the trim on the inside and outside has to be removed to install it. Also, a special, flexible two-part adhesive and sealer has to be used to accomodate the expansion and contraction of the glass. I wasn't lucky enough to get the glass at the price some of you managed but at least I beat the price increase.

There have been threads for several months about the slider. I don't like it because I don't like to see the two verticle bars in the mirror. Besides, here in the South West, the increased tint can cut the in-cab temperature by about 15 degrees and that is significant.
I personally think it looks much better without the slider but everyone has his or her own opinion.
